Rajpura Junction railway station
Railway station
Rajpura Junction railway station is a railway station serving Rajpura city in Patiala district, Punjab, India. Rajpura is the administrative headquarter of Rajpura subdivision of Patiala district. Rajpura Junction railway station is situated 4 km northwest of Rajpura.

Rajpura
Rajpura is a city and a municipal council in Patiala district in the Indian state of Punjab, India, situated along the border of the Indian state of Haryana.Rajpura
